Hexamethylentetramin, Diphenylguanidin) durch die Gegenwart von Oxyden der Metalle der zweiten Gruppe des periodischen Systems wesentlich verstärkt wird.Fast drying paints It has long been known that various super oxides, e.g. B. Benzoylsuperoxid, resinous turpentine oil, etc., able to accelerate the drying of chemically drying paints to a small extent. In the course of the last few years a number of organic substances such as carbanilide, thiocarbanilide, hexamethylenetetramine, diphenylguanidine (M ar 1 in in Drugs, O i 1 s and P aints, Vol. XL II, Philadelphia, April 1927, issue No. ii, page 373), became known that on chemically drying paints, such as oils, stand oils, sulfurized oils, oil varnishes. Oil and oil varnish paints, as well as fillers, putties, artist paints, etc. made using drying, greasy oils, in the presence or absence of dry metal substances (so-called siccatives) exert a very slight drying acceleration, which in some of them (e.g. Hexamethylenetetramine, diphenylguanidine) is significantly increased by the presence of oxides of the metals of the second group of the periodic table.

Bei rohem Holzöl kann durch denselben Zusatz die Staubtrocknung von etwa 70 Stunden auf etwa 6 Stunden herabgedrückt werden.It has now been found that the phenylhydrazones of aliphatic ketones are able to accelerate the drying of chemically drying paints much more intensively and universally. Not only that they are effective in the absence of metal oxides, even of metal desiccants (siccatives), they accelerate both linseed oil and linseed oil products as well as wood oil and wood oil products. Examples i. Raw linseed oil, spread in a thin layer on a glass plate, is dust-dry in about 70 hours; by adding 1% acetone phenylhydrazone it dries in about 30 hours. With raw wood oil, the same addition can reduce the dust drying time from around 70 hours to around 6 hours.

A black paint, consisting of 41 parts by weight of ivory black, 1 part by weight of carbon black, 29 parts by weight of stand oil, 2o parts by weight of Copal resin ester oil varnish, g parts by weight of mineral spirits, .1 part by weight of cobalt-lead-calcium siccative, dries in about 27 hours. By adding 0.8% of the phenylhydrazone of methyl ethyl ketone the drying time can be reduced to about 6 1/2 hours.
